> I needed a couple of right angle drives for my vacuum variables but could
not find them anywhere. Nobody seems to stock the Cardwell units. I
researched the mechanical engineering shop option, they just wanted a lot of
money for simple bevel gears, plus i had to build the unit.
>
> Walking through a tool shop recently i discovered cheap  drill right angle
drill chuck adapters. These are excellemt right angle drives for  vacuum
variables. These units are made in the far east. The package is a completely
sealed plastic moulding. I simply remove the chuck and side handle and you
have a superb right angle drive. They are selling from $ 10 to $15 a piece.
Milwaukee tools have several in their catalogue. The shafts are not a 1/4
inch however. You could if you wanted too leave the chuck on this is a bit
heavy and bulky.
>
> Anyhows now we amp builders have  very little excuse for not mounting vac
variables the right way up. I noticed a number of sources on the net
discounting this particular cheap chinese brand. This might be a futile post
since i never found out what a Cardwell right angle drive sold for. Compared
to what the Surplus Sales wants for  a surplus unit this cheap unit is a
good bet.
